#a47134 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a47134 is composed of 64.3% red, 44.3%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 68.3%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 42.4%. #a47134 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e268 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#a47134 color description : Dark mo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#a47134 has RGB values of R:164, G:113,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.68,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10776884.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#faf6f0 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726d66 is the less saturated color, while #d67502 is the most saturated one.
